Biometrics, the word not only generates a spark of interest but it
is also an important aspect to trace human expressions. Signature,
an expression of this kind portrays a uniqueness which can be
captured thus it becomes vital. Signature is a mark of authenticity
which can be tampered by observing carefully. Dynamic Signature
Recognition is one of the highly accurate biometric traits. Live
signature of the person is captured, hence it is possible to have
dynamic characteristics of signature for matching purpose. The
signature captured by digitizer gives information about dynamic
nature of signature and pressure applied while signing. This book
is discussing use of Dynamic Signature Recognition using Hybrid
wavelets. The technique is fast and gives good accuracy and tested
in real time. Hybrid Wavelets are used for feature vector
extraction, this is done by multiresolution analysis of the dynamic
signatures. Wavelet energy based feature vector is generated and
this is to be used for the matching of the signatures. The typical
features set consists of x, y, z co-ordinates, Pressure, Azimuth
and Altitude points. For performance evaluation we are using
Conventional FAR-FRR analysis.
Mesalamine is a drug of choice for the treatment of inflammatory
bowel disease. Mesalamine has been shown to block the production of
interlukin-1 (1L-1) and tumor necrosis factor-a (TNF-alpha.
Further, MSA is found to have free radical scavenger and
antioxidant effect. Therefore, the aim shall be to understand the
analytical, physical and spectral attributes of this most useful
drug molecule. This Monograph explores solubility aspects,
hygroscopicity, partition coefficient, FTIR-spectroscopic analysis,
differential scanning calorimetry, TGA, X-ray diffraction, 1H-NMR,
13C-NMR spectroscopic analysis. The chapter on analytical profile
employing UV-Visible spectroscopic method, spectrofluorimetric
method and HPLC method (Blood Plasma, Rat caecal content, etc.)are
useful for the researcher
The book entitled with "Complex Manifolds and its submanifolds"
deals with the properties of quarter symmetric non metric
connection in a nearly kaehler manifold, generalized
CR-submanifolds of quasi kaehler manifolds. The integrability
conditions of the distribution involved in the definition of such
manifolds. Geometry of leaves of such distributions are also given
and almost Hermitian manifold equipped with semi symmetric non
metric connections. The properties of a contravarient almost
analytic vector field with semi symmetric non metric connection are
also given.
The present study reveals a part of the systemic annotation which
includes the use of a proteomic tool with PEG mediated
fractionation of plant proteome proteins for characterizing the
explant(s) in order to study functional genomic approaches in
tissue culture based sugarcane improvement programme. Stem segments
derived in vitro propagated sugarcane leaves were used, for
selection of salt tolerant callus lines and also for proteomic
analysis.
